Home > Research > Publications & Outputs > Cache as a service

Electronic data

  • P.Georgopoulos_ICCCN2014

    Rights statement: Rights remain with publisher and authors.

    Accepted author manuscript, 2.48 MB, PDF document

Links

Text available via DOI:

View graph of relations

Cache as a service: leveraging SDN to efficiently and transparently support Video-on-Demand on the last mile

Research output: Contribution in Book/Report/Proceedings - With ISBN/ISSNConference contribution/Paperpeer-review

Published
Close
Publication date2014
Host publication23rd International Conference on Computer Communications and Networks (ICCCN 2014)
PublisherIEEE
Pages1-9
Number of pages9
<mark>Original language</mark>English
Event23rd International Conference on Computer Communications and Networks (ICCCN 2014) - Shanghai, China
Duration: 4/08/20147/08/2014

Conference

Conference23rd International Conference on Computer Communications and Networks (ICCCN 2014)
Country/TerritoryChina
CityShanghai
Period4/08/147/08/14

Conference

Conference23rd International Conference on Computer Communications and Networks (ICCCN 2014)
Country/TerritoryChina
CityShanghai
Period4/08/147/08/14

Abstract

High quality online video streaming, both live and on-demand, has become an essential part of consumers’ every-day lives. The popularity of video streaming as placed a heavy burden on the network infrastructure that now has to transfer an enormous amount of data very quickly to the end-user. To further exacerbate the situation, the Video-on-Demand (VoD) distribution paradigm uses a unicast independent flow for each user request. This results in multiple duplicate flows carrying the same video assets many times end-to-end. We present OpenCache: a highly configurable, efficient and transparent in-network caching service that aims to improve the VoD distribution efficiency by caching video assets as close to the end-user as possible. OpenCache leverages Software Defined Networking to benefit last mile environments by improving network utilisation and increasing the Quality of Experience for the end-user. Our evaluation on a pan-European OpenFlow testbed uses adaptive video streaming and demonstrates that with the use of OpenCache, the external link utilisation is reduced by 100%. Furthermore the streaming application receives better quality video and observes higher throughput, lower latency and shorter start up and buffering times.